    @Mike van der Valk - no problem. I will say my biggest sore point though is the QBO integration. It’s really just not there. As a PM, I hope you’ve spent time looking at Insightly, Method and others that have a far more elegant sync with QBO. FWIW and IMHO, QBO should be source of truth, not Pipedrive. Creating invoices, barring the feedback above, in PipeDrive is great - but it’s the information regarding those invoices that are more important - especially around late payments, recurring payments and renewal opportunities. I’ve got a bit of a workaround currently. But honestly, the feature just isn’t there yet. As discussed above, a first step would simply be to allow for linking and unlinking of invoices - and again - using the data of that invoice as  the source of truth. (And, as I recently experienced, if an invoice Is deleted or replaced in QBO, Pipedrive shouldn’t hold on to the old pointer.)
